Skip to content

Instantly share code, notes, and snippets.

import 'package:flutter/material.dart';
void main() => runApp(App());
class App extends StatelessWidget {
const App({Key? key}) : super(key: key);
@override
Widget build(BuildContext context) {
return MaterialApp(home: Main(),);
import 'package:flutter/material.dart';
void main() => runApp(App());
class App extends StatelessWidget {
const App({Key? key}) : super(key: key);
@override
Widget build(BuildContext context) {
return MaterialApp(home: Main(),);
@doyle-flutter
doyle-flutter / fanim01.dart
Created August 19, 2021 15:09
Flutter Anim 01
import 'package:flutter/foundation.dart';
import 'package:flutter/material.dart';
void main() => runApp(App());
class App extends StatelessWidget {
const App({Key? key}) : super(key: key);
@override
Widget build(BuildContext context) {
import 'dart:async';
import 'dart:io';
import 'dart:convert';
void main() async {
bool cmdClose = false;
bool check(String? cmd) => cmd == null || cmd == "F" || cmd.isEmpty;
import 'package:flutter/foundation.dart';
import 'package:flutter/material.dart';
void main() => runApp(App());
class App extends StatelessWidget {
const App({Key? key}) : super(key: key);
@override
Widget build(BuildContext context) {
import 'package:flutter/foundation.dart';
import 'package:flutter/material.dart';
void main() => runApp(App());
class App extends StatelessWidget {
const App({Key? key}) : super(key: key);
@override
Widget build(BuildContext context) {
@doyle-flutter
doyle-flutter / adNodeJsHTML.html
Created August 5, 2021 00:37
행안부 주소 검색 OPEN API - HTML
<!DOCTYPE html>
<html lang="ko">
<head>
<meta charset="UTF-8">
<meta http-equiv="X-UA-Compatible" content="IE=edge">
<meta name="viewport" content="width=device-width, initial-scale=1.0">
<title>주소</title>
</head>
<body>
<script>
@doyle-flutter
doyle-flutter / adFlutter.dart
Created August 4, 2021 06:03
행안부 주소 검색 OPEN API - Flutter
import 'dart:io';
import 'package:flutter/material.dart';
import 'package:webview_flutter/webview_flutter.dart';
/// [pub] webview_flutter: ^2.0.10 : https://pub.dev/packages/webview_flutter
void main() => runApp(Sys());
class Sys extends StatelessWidget {
const Sys({Key? key}) : super(key: key);
@doyle-flutter
doyle-flutter / adNodeJs.js
Created August 4, 2021 06:02
행안부 주소 검색 OPEN API - NodeJS
const express = require('express'),
app = express(),
path = require('path'),
port = process.env.PORT || 3000,
_v = app.listen(port, _ => console.log(`Start : ${port}`));
app.use(express.json());
app.use(express.urlencoded({extended: false}));
app.post('/', (req,res) => res.redirect("/com?data="+req.body.roadFullAddr));
@doyle-flutter
doyle-flutter / clickDragExample.dart
Created July 29, 2021 01:59
Click Drag - Arrow Example
import 'package:flutter/material.dart';
void main() => runApp(Sys());
class Sys extends StatelessWidget {
const Sys({Key? key}) : super(key: key);
@override
Widget build(BuildContext context) {
return MaterialApp(home: Main(),);